Intel® Embedded Server RAID BIOS Configuration Utility Screen Creating, Adding or Modifying a Virtual Drive Configuration To create, add, or modify a virtual drive configuration, follow these steps: 1. Boot the system. 2. Press + when prompted to start the Intel® Embedded Server RAID BIOS Configuration utility. 3. Select Configure from the Main Menu. 4. Select a configuration method: - Easy Configuration does not change existing configurations but allows new configurations. - New Configuration deletes any existing arrays and virtual drives and creates only new configurations. - View/Add Configuration lets you view or modify an existing configuration. For each configuration method, a list of available physical drives is displayed. These drives are in the READY state. If you select a physical drive in the list, information about each drive is displayed. 5. Use the arrow keys to move to a drive and press the space bar to add it to the array. 40 Intel® RAID Software User's Guide
